Native published input

Table 3 N=36 disk row:n_e0=3.4e-3 cm-3,R0=7.0 kpc,z0=2.7 kpc。

Table 3 N=36 disk row: n_e0=3.4e-3 cm-3, R0=7.0 kpc, z0=2.7 kpc.

Conversion chain

逐M31视线积分n_e n_H并用kT=0.22 keV APEC、HI4PI phabs和observed weights。

Integrate n_e n_H through each M31 sightline and use kT=0.22 keV APEC, HI4PI phabs, and the observed weights.

  1. 采用Ueda Table 3的2005--2009、|l|>105 deg、N=36 exponential disk fit:n_e0=3.4e-3 cm^-3、R0=7.0 kpc、z0=2.7 kpc。Adopt the Ueda Table 3 exponential-disk fit for 2005--2009, |l|>105 deg, N=36: n_e0=3.4e-3 cm^-3, R0=7.0 kpc, z0=2.7 kpc.
  2. 从太阳位置沿每条M31 field sightline积分published density geometry;本项目明确补充对称|z|和n_H=n_e/1.2。Integrate the published density geometry from the Solar position along each M31-field sightline; this project explicitly adds symmetric |z| and n_H=n_e/1.2.EM(l,b) = ∫ n_e(R,z) n_H(R,z) ds
  3. 用kT=0.22 keV、Lodders APEC与field-specific HI4PI phabs将EM转为absorbed 0.5--2 brightness;以实测CGMsum statistical weights求all-field mean,14-field min--max只表示footprint。Convert EM to absorbed 0.5--2 brightness with kT=0.22 keV, Lodders APEC, and field-specific HI4PI phabs; use the measured CGMsum statistical weights for the all-field mean, while the 14-field min--max represents footprint variation only.
